时间:2024-11-02 来源:网络 人气:
在Windows操作系统中,.bat文件是一种常用的批处理文件,它允许用户通过一系列命令来自动执行任务。本文将详细介绍如何编写一个功能强大的.bat文件,帮助您实现自动化操作,提高工作效率。
什么是.bat文件?
.bat文件是一种扩展名为.bat的文本文件,它包含了Windows批处理命令。这些命令可以用来执行各种操作,如打开程序、复制文件、删除文件等。通过编写批处理脚本,用户可以自动化日常任务,节省时间和精力。
1. 选择合适的文本编辑器
编写.bat文件可以使用任何文本编辑器,如记事本、Notepad++、Sublime Text等。建议使用支持语法高亮的编辑器,以便更好地阅读和编写代码。
2. 熟悉批处理命令
在编写.bat文件之前,需要熟悉一些常用的批处理命令,如echo、copy、del、start等。这些命令可以帮助您实现各种功能。
示例:创建一个简单的.bat文件,用于打开记事本
1. 打开文本编辑器,创建一个新的文本文件。
2. 在文件中输入以下命令:
@echo off
start notepad.exe
3. 保存文件,并命名为“open_notepad.bat”。
4. 双击运行该文件,即可打开记事本。
1. 条件语句
批处理文件中的条件语句可以使用if命令实现。以下是一个示例,用于检查当前日期是否为周末:
@echo off
set /a day_of_week=%date:~10,1%
if %day_of_week%==6 (
echo It's Saturday!
) else if %day_of_week%==7 (
echo It's Sunday!
) else (
echo It's a weekday.
2. 循环
批处理文件中的循环可以使用for命令实现。以下是一个示例,用于遍历一个文件夹中的所有文件并打印它们的名称:
@echo off
for %%f in (C:folder.txt) do (
echo %%f
1. 脚本权限
在编写.bat文件时,需要注意脚本权限。如果脚本包含敏感操作,如删除文件或修改系统设置,请确保以管理员身份运行。
2. 脚本调试
在编写复杂的批处理脚本时,建议使用echo命令在脚本中添加调试信息,以便跟踪脚本执行过程。
通过学习本文,您应该已经掌握了编写.bat文件的基本技巧。利用批处理脚本,您可以轻松实现自动化任务,提高工作效率。在今后的工作中,不妨尝试将更多任务自动化,让生活更加便捷。